"You really think I would be of any help in such a situation?" Her smile was flattered and dubious, the idea of entering hidden and forgotten places both scary and alluring. Gratified that he even considered her for such a task erased some of the envy from her mind, and Maea even straightened her back when he agreed to show her the rapier.

Though somewhat surprised as Jigano seemed intent on turning this into a fullscale lecture rather than just letting her hold the blade, she did as he asked and came up to the table. The weapon gleamed in the firelight and seemed both beautiful and frightening to her eyes, a potential for protection and a sure promise of pain. Long, slender, lethal... a quick glance at her teacher had Maea wondering if the man was in any way similar to the blade.

"Haft, pommel, handle, basket, kvi...kvillon" she repeated, stumbling somewhat on the foreign word. "The strong base is for blocking, the weaker tip is for attacking, and the middle can do both. Go ahead, I can keep up." Her eyes might be bad, but her memory was all the better for lack of visual support. Not flawless, no, but she was good at memorizing.

Less skilled at avoiding difficult questions though. It was not one she could shrug of easily either, but... was it something for others to know about?

"I wouldn't say that we are close. But..." Maea hesitated, then looked at the blue eyed man from under her heavy bangs, considering. Perhaps if it was Jigano, talking about it would be alright. Ludo had not said it was a secret.

"Ludo appeared, a while ago. I was praying like I always do, and... for the first time, I was answered. I asked if there was a way to fix my eyes... We made a deal."

Maea knew it should terrify her, that she ought to worry and consider this bargain carefully... But truth be told, she was not the least bit scared. Ludo had been gentle and kind, and asked for her trust. Just thinking about it, and the way the God har sought her out in the midst of a crowd was enough to make her smile. Softly, tenderly... It was not just for the sake of her eyes she looked forward to meeting the miscievous soulkeeper again.
